A familiar vocal powerhouse is coming back to TV screens this fall and that’s Oscar Award-winning singer, Jennifer Hudson.

The star is reportedly all set to join the cast of NBC’s The Voice as the fourth and final coach for Season 13.

The new season will bring back main stay revolving chair coaches Adam Levin and Blake Shelton. Miley Cyrus is also scheduled to return, giving Gwen Stefani a break.

In the announcement, Paul Telegdy, President of Alternative and Reality Group and NBC Entertainment stated, “Jennifer is an extraordinary vocal talent and one of the premier voices of our time. She embodies the experience, expertise, positivity and sheer talent that The Voice stands for.”

See, Jennifer is no newcomer to show. The 35-year-old actually served as a coach for The Voice UK, where she stole the show and won the season with her mentee singer Mo Adeniran this past April.
